The Science of Sound in Caves

The science behind the exceptional acoustics in caves is fascinating. Caves are natural resonators, meaning they amplify sound waves in specific ways due to their unique shape and composition. The hard, irregular surfaces of the cave walls reflect sound waves in multiple directions, creating a rich, reverberant sound field. This phenomenon is known as reverberation, and it's what gives cave concerts their distinctive sonic character.

Unlike traditional concert halls, which use engineered materials to control sound reflections, caves offer a natural and organic reverberation. In practice, the irregular surfaces scatter sound waves more randomly, resulting in a more diffuse and immersive sound field. This can enhance the perceived loudness and richness of the music, making it sound fuller and more vibrant And it works..

On top of that, the temperature and humidity levels in caves can also affect sound propagation. Cool, humid air is denser than warm, dry air, which can alter the speed and direction of sound waves. This can create subtle variations in the sound quality depending on the specific conditions within the cave.

The Allure of Tennessee's Cave Systems

Tennessee is blessed with an abundance of caves, thanks to its unique geology and climate. The state lies within the Appalachian Plateau and the Interior Low Plateau, both of which are characterized by karst topography. Still, karst topography is a landscape formed by the dissolution of soluble rocks, such as limestone and dolomite. Over millions of years, rainwater and groundwater have slowly dissolved these rocks, creating an nuanced network of underground caves, sinkholes, and springs Not complicated — just consistent..

Tennessee is home to thousands of caves, ranging from small, unassuming grottos to vast, interconnected systems that stretch for miles. Some of the most famous caves in Tennessee include the Cumberland Caverns, the Lost Sea Adventure, and Ruby Falls. These caves attract thousands of visitors each year, drawn by their natural beauty and geological significance.

Real-World Examples

One of the most popular cave concert venues in Tennessee is the Cumberland Caverns, located in McMinnville. Think about it: cumberland Caverns has been hosting concerts for over 50 years and is known for its unique Volcano Room, a large chamber with exceptional acoustics. The venue has hosted a wide range of artists, including Loretta Lynn, Little Feat, and the Zac Brown Band Not complicated — just consistent. Surprisingly effective..

Another notable venue is The Caverns, located in Pelham. But the Caverns is a relatively new venue but has quickly gained a reputation for its top-tier sound and lighting systems and its diverse lineup of musical acts. The venue has hosted artists such as The Avett Brothers, Jason Isbell, and Widespread Panic.
